What are Montana's specific firearm purchasing laws I should know about when buying from an East Helena gun shop?

Montana has no state permit required to purchase rifles, shotguns, or handguns, and no firearm registration. However, federal background checks via the NICS system are required for purchases from licensed dealers in East Helena. Montana also recognizes constitutional carry for residents 18+, but you must be 21+ to purchase a handgun from an FFL.

How does the FFL transfer process work at East Helena gun shops for online purchases?

When you purchase a firearm online, you must have it shipped to a licensed FFL in East Helena, such as Capital Sports or The Gun Rack. You'll contact the shop in advance, pay their transfer fee (typically $25-$50), complete the required federal Form 4473 and background check upon pickup, and comply with Montana state laws regarding the firearm type.

First and foremost, a federal firearms license (FFL) is the non-negotiable foundation. This license, issued by the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ives (ATF), ensures the shop operates within federal and state laws, conducting mandatory background checks through the National Instant Criminal Background Check System (NICS). In Montana, our state laws are generally supportive of gun rights, but a reputable shop will always ensure every transaction is compliant and secure. This legal backbone provides you, the customer, with confidence and peace of mind.
